Millers Defeated By Cray Valley

Aveley was defeated by fellow Millers 2-0 on a cold Tuesday night in The Emirates FA Cup.

The Millers traveled to fellow Millers in the Emirates FA Cup Third Qualifying Round as two Isthmian clubs went head to head to make it to the Fourth Qualifying Round, one round away from the First Round Proper. Before the game, Mitch Gilbey had to pull out, and central defender George Allen come into the team which changed our formation.

Despite the change of formation, we started really well, ball after ball was going into the Cray Valley PM penalty area which was all defended well. Harry Donovan had an effort and was clipped as he did, there were shouts for a penalty but it was turned down.

The hosts grew into the game and used their blistering pace upfront to get in behind, covering tackles from George Allen, Harry Gibbs and Steve Sheehan denied Cray Valley any chances in the opening 25 minutes.

The Millers had another penalty shout as the ball struck the Cray Valley defender on the arm, his arm was raised in the box and the ball struck it, resulting in the ball being diverted away from George Sykes in the box, the ball went out for a corner which was well defended again.

We continued to dominate and push for the opening goal, George Allen connected sweetly to a volley that was well blocked, Harry Donovan then saw his effort blocked and moments later George Sykes struck towards goal but his follow-through caught Ashley Sains who went down.

After those glut of chances, Cray Valley started to create half-chances, Kieran McCann raced down our left-hand side, but for a superb recovery challenge by Connor Witherspoon, the hosts could've taken the lead.

We had the best chance of the first half at the end which landed to Alex Clark, he was at a slight angle at goal, fired with his left foot but fired it an inch wide of the left-hand post.

With the last five minutes of the half Cray Valley dominated, ball after ball was put into the box, but David Hughes commanded his area well, but in truth, neither goalkeeper had to really make saves as this game was dominated by strong defences.

Half Time | Cray Valley PM 0-0 Aveley.

We had our chance of the game a minute into the second half, this time the Cray Valley keeper had his one and only save of the game, as he got down well to finger-tip a left-footed shot from Alex Clark. The resulting corner came to nothing.

Moments after that chance we found ourselves behind, a counter-attack was well worked down our left-hand side, the ball was pulled back to Ade Yussuf who slammed home, a clinical finish with David Hughes having no chance to save it. Cray Valley PM 1-0 Aveley.

For the rest of the game, it was a frustrating one for Aveley. Ali Tumkaya misjudged the ball, it came to Alex Clark who was in-behind but a superb recovery from Tumkaya denied Alex Clark a shot at goal.

Alex Clark had a chance from 25-yards from a free-kick but he curled it just over the crossbar. A long throw into the box found Steve Sheehan he had a shot which clearly hit an arm on the balls way towards the goal, but it was two-foot away, Premier League VAR probably a penalty but it would've been harsh in the shoe was on the other foot.

With twenty minutes to go, it was all Aveley with corner after corner and long throw after long throw, but the ball just wouldn't fall to us in the box as Cray Valley remained resilient at the back.

We brought on Bradley Sach and Manny Ogunrinde to throw the kitchen sink to grab an equaliser to force penalties, but it just didn't come. The hosts counter-attacked us when we were throwing bodies forward, a great ball down our left-hand side was then cut back to the back stick and Ade Yussuf connected to find the roof of the net to finish the game off. Cray Valley PM 2-0 Aveley.

Full Time | Cray Valley PM 2-0 Aveley.

Millers XI | David Hughes, Jason Ring, George Winn (Manny Ogunrinde 72), Connor Witherspoon (Bradley Sach 80), Harry Gibbs, Steve Sheehan, Alex Clark, Harry Donovan, George Sykes, James Goode, George Allen.

Unused subs | Freddie Gard, Mitchell Gilbey, Jack Mochalski.

Cray Valley PM XI | Andrew Walker, Connor Dymond, Liam Hickey, Ashley Sains, Ali Tumkaya, Denzel Gayle (Ryan King-Elliot 84), Ade Adeyemo (Matthew Warren 70), Francis Babalola, Hassan Ibrahiym, Ade Yussuf.

Unused subs | Daniel Smith, Oliver Farmer, Joe Docherty, Harry Thomas.
